Firma:
export interface TestEnvironmentConfig
Propiedades
Propiedad | Tipo | Descripción |
---|---|---|
base de datos | Configuración del emulador | El emulador de base de datos. Su host y puerto también se pueden descubrir automáticamente a través del concentrador (consulte el campo "hub") o especificarse mediante la variable de entorno FIREBASE_DATABASE_EMULATOR_HOST. |
tienda de fuego | Configuración del emulador | El emulador de Firestore. Su host y puerto también se pueden descubrir automáticamente a través del concentrador (consulte el campo "hub") o especificarse mediante la variable de entorno FIRESTORE_EMULATOR_HOST. |
centro | HostYPuerto | El centro del emulador de Firebase. También se puede especificar mediante la variable de entorno FIREBASE_EMULATOR_HUB. Si se especifica de cualquier manera, se pueden descubrir automáticamente otros emuladores en ejecución y, por lo tanto, no se deben especificar explícitamente. |
Projecto ID | cadena | El ID del proyecto del entorno de prueba. También se puede especificar mediante la variable de entorno GCLOUD_PROJECT. Se recomienda encarecidamente un ID de proyecto "demo-*", especialmente para pruebas unitarias. Ver: https://firebase.google.com/docs/emulator-suite/connect_firestore#choose_a_firebase_project |
almacenamiento | Configuración del emulador | El emulador de almacenamiento. Su host y puerto también se pueden descubrir automáticamente a través del concentrador (consulte el campo "hub") o especificarse mediante la variable de entorno FIREBASE_STORAGE_EMULATOR_HOST. |
TestEnvironmentConfig.base de datos
El emulador de base de datos. Su host y puerto también se pueden descubrir automáticamente a través del concentrador (consulte el campo "hub") o especificarse mediante la variable de entorno FIREBASE_DATABASE_EMULATOR_HOST.
Firma:
database?: EmulatorConfig;
TestEnvironmentConfig.firestore
El emulador de Firestore. Su host y puerto también se pueden descubrir automáticamente a través del concentrador (consulte el campo "hub") o especificarse mediante la variable de entorno FIRESTORE_EMULATOR_HOST.
Firma:
firestore?: EmulatorConfig;
TestEnvironmentConfig.hub
El centro del emulador de Firebase. También se puede especificar mediante la variable de entorno FIREBASE_EMULATOR_HUB. Si se especifica de cualquier manera, se pueden descubrir automáticamente otros emuladores en ejecución y, por lo tanto, no se deben especificar explícitamente.
Firma:
hub?: HostAndPort;
TestEnvironmentConfig.projectId
El ID del proyecto del entorno de prueba. También se puede especificar mediante la variable de entorno GCLOUD_PROJECT.
Se recomienda encarecidamente un ID de proyecto "demo-*", especialmente para pruebas unitarias. Ver: https://firebase.google.com/docs/emulator-suite/connect_firestore#choose_a_firebase_project
Firma:
projectId?: string;
TestEnvironmentConfig.almacenamiento
El emulador de almacenamiento. Su host y puerto también se pueden descubrir automáticamente a través del concentrador (consulte el campo "hub") o especificarse mediante la variable de entorno FIREBASE_STORAGE_EMULATOR_HOST.
Firma:
storage?: EmulatorConfig;
, Configuración del entorno de pruebas unitarias, incluidos los emuladores.Firma:
export interface TestEnvironmentConfig
Propiedades
Propiedad | Tipo | Descripción |
---|---|---|
base de datos | Configuración del emulador | El emulador de base de datos. Su host y puerto también se pueden descubrir automáticamente a través del concentrador (consulte el campo "hub") o especificarse mediante la variable de entorno FIREBASE_DATABASE_EMULATOR_HOST. |
tienda de fuego | Configuración del emulador | El emulador de Firestore. Su host y puerto también se pueden descubrir automáticamente a través del concentrador (consulte el campo "hub") o especificarse mediante la variable de entorno FIRESTORE_EMULATOR_HOST. |
centro | HostYPuerto | El centro del emulador de Firebase. También se puede especificar mediante la variable de entorno FIREBASE_EMULATOR_HUB. Si se especifica de cualquier manera, se pueden descubrir automáticamente otros emuladores en ejecución y, por lo tanto, no se deben especificar explícitamente. |
Projecto ID | cadena | El ID del proyecto del entorno de prueba. También se puede especificar mediante la variable de entorno GCLOUD_PROJECT. Se recomienda encarecidamente un ID de proyecto "demo-*", especialmente para pruebas unitarias. Ver: https://firebase.google.com/docs/emulator-suite/connect_firestore#choose_a_firebase_project |
almacenamiento | Configuración del emulador | El emulador de almacenamiento. Su host y puerto también se pueden descubrir automáticamente a través del concentrador (consulte el campo "hub") o especificarse mediante la variable de entorno FIREBASE_STORAGE_EMULATOR_HOST. |
TestEnvironmentConfig.base de datos
El emulador de base de datos. Su host y puerto también se pueden descubrir automáticamente a través del concentrador (consulte el campo "hub") o especificarse mediante la variable de entorno FIREBASE_DATABASE_EMULATOR_HOST.
Firma:
database?: EmulatorConfig;
TestEnvironmentConfig.firestore
El emulador de Firestore. Su host y puerto también se pueden descubrir automáticamente a través del concentrador (consulte el campo "hub") o especificarse mediante la variable de entorno FIRESTORE_EMULATOR_HOST.
Firma:
firestore?: EmulatorConfig;
TestEnvironmentConfig.hub
El centro del emulador de Firebase. También se puede especificar mediante la variable de entorno FIREBASE_EMULATOR_HUB. Si se especifica de cualquier manera, se pueden descubrir automáticamente otros emuladores en ejecución y, por lo tanto, no se deben especificar explícitamente.
Firma:
hub?: HostAndPort;
TestEnvironmentConfig.projectId
El ID del proyecto del entorno de prueba. También se puede especificar mediante la variable de entorno GCLOUD_PROJECT.
Se recomienda encarecidamente un ID de proyecto "demo-*", especialmente para pruebas unitarias. Ver: https://firebase.google.com/docs/emulator-suite/connect_firestore#choose_a_firebase_project
Firma:
projectId?: string;
TestEnvironmentConfig.almacenamiento
El emulador de almacenamiento. Su host y puerto también se pueden descubrir automáticamente a través del concentrador (consulte el campo "hub") o especificarse mediante la variable de entorno FIREBASE_STORAGE_EMULATOR_HOST.
Firma:
storage?: EmulatorConfig;